Experimental Evaluations of Thinned-out and PDM Controlled Class-E Rectifier

Abstract(in English) This paper presents a design of the closed-loop thinned-out controlled class-E rectifier. It is possible to realize both thinned-out control and the PDM one at the same control-circuit topology. In addition, fine output-voltage controls can be achieved because the control circuit can make a thinned-out signal at any thinned-out ratio. For evaluating the proposed class-E rectifier, the resonant dc/dc converter with the class-DE inverter and the proposed class-E rectifier is designed and implemented. The control characteristics of the resonant converter were measured for load and input-voltage variations. It is seen from the experimental results that the thinned-out control provides higher efficiency than the PDM control. In addition, the power spectrum of the switch voltages suggested that the cutoff frequency of the low-pass filter for thinned-out control can be higher than those for the PDM control, which contributes circuit-volume reduction.
